What legal issues should be considered when setting up a payment system?
When setting up a payment system, there are a few legal issues to consider in order to ensure compliance with District of Columbia e-commerce law. First, the payment system and the seller must comply with all relevant consumer protection laws. This includes laws that protect customers from being overcharged, misrepresentation, and fraudulent activity. The payment system must also comply with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) and any other applicable laws. Second, the payment system must comply with applicable laws relating to data protection and privacy. This includes collecting, storing, and using customer data responsibly. It is important to have robust security measures in place to protect customer information. Third, the payment system must also comply with laws and regulations relating to intellectual property rights. This includes laws surrounding copyright, patents, trademarks, and trade secrets. Finally, the payment system must also comply with laws relating to money laundering and fraud prevention. This means that the systems must be designed to detect and prevent any suspicious or potentially illegal financial activity. In sum, when setting up a payment system, it is important to make sure that all relevant consumer protection, data privacy, intellectual property, and fraud prevention laws are taken into consideration. This will help ensure full compliance with District of Columbia e-commerce law.
